One of a series of caches named for a sweet kid who has been
diagnosed with autism. Buglet is part of a great caching family and
these are his kind of hides.
You are looking for a painted Sucrets tin on a bridge along the
jogging/walking/bicycle trail running southwest from Lackman Park,
near the southwest corner of 79th & Lackman, to Ad Astra Park.
This part of the trail runs along the creek between backyards. It's
a short walk from parking on the nearby Woodstone Street or a bit
longer walk from the parks at either end of the trail. This cache
was placed with the permission of Lenexa Parks and
Recreation.
This one is a just a little bit trickier to get to than the others
in this series. Be careful.
